DH got this recipe out of one of those Kraft magazines and it makes meatloaf so much easier! After you mix up the meat, you use a greased muffin pan and press the mixture into each cup. Leave a well in the center of each meatloaf and you can fill that with some sort of sauce (bbq, pizza, etc) and top with the appropriate cheese.

He filled ours with pizza sauce and mozzerella and the kids thought they were so cool! The nice thing is that they cook in about 1/2 the time of a normal sized meatloaf.

I'm pretty sure that he only mixed bread crumbs, egg & some salt and pepper in the meat itself, but I'll double check with him when he wakes up.
